How to Use Tire Pressure and Temperature Data to Improve Safety

Maintaining proper tire pressure and monitoring temperature are essential for vehicle safety. Incorrect tire pressure can lead to poor handling, increased tire wear, and a higher risk of blowouts. Temperature fluctuations can also affect tire performance, especially during long drives or in extreme weather conditions.

Understanding Tire Pressure

Tire pressure is the amount of air inside a tire, measured in pounds per square inch (PSI). Proper pressure ensures optimal contact with the road, which improves traction and fuel efficiency. Overinflated or underinflated tires can compromise safety and cause uneven wear.

How to Check Tire Pressure

  • Use a reliable tire pressure gauge.
  • Check the pressure when the tires are cold, ideally before driving.
  • Compare the reading with the recommended PSI found in your vehicle’s owner manual or on the driver’s side door.

Regularly checking tire pressure helps prevent accidents caused by underinflated or overinflated tires. It is recommended to check at least once a month and before long trips.

The Role of Temperature in Tire Safety

Tire temperature affects the pressure inside the tire. As the tire heats up during driving, the air expands, increasing pressure. Conversely, in cold weather, the pressure can drop, reducing grip and increasing the risk of tire failure.

Monitoring Temperature Data

  • Many modern vehicles are equipped with tire pressure monitoring systems (TPMS) that also track temperature.
  • Use external sensors or infrared thermometers to measure tire temperature manually.
  • Be aware of temperature changes, especially during extreme weather or after long drives.

Significant temperature increases can indicate overloading, excessive speed, or other issues that might compromise safety. Addressing these early can prevent tire blowouts or accidents.

Using Data to Improve Safety

Combining tire pressure and temperature data allows for better maintenance and safer driving. Here are some tips:

  • Adjust tire pressure based on temperature conditions and load.
  • Use TPMS data to identify abnormal temperature spikes or pressure drops.
  • Replace tires showing persistent high temperatures or uneven wear patterns.

Consistent monitoring and timely adjustments enhance vehicle safety, improve fuel efficiency, and extend tire lifespan. Always follow manufacturer guidelines and consult professionals if unsure about tire conditions.
